Why Guttering Matters
Gutters play a crucial function in directing rainwater away from the roof and foundation of a home. Without a reliable guttering system, excess water can cause a variety of issues, consisting of:
- Foundation Damage: Water pooling around the structure can deteriorate soil and result in cracks.
- Roof Damage: Clogged gutters can cause water to support onto the roof, causing leakages and rot.
- Landscaping Erosion: Water can get rid of soil and damage gardens or landscaping.
- Insect Infestation: Stagnant water draws in insects like mosquitoes and termites.
Table 1: Common Problems Caused by Poor Guttering
| Problem | Description | Effects |
|---|---|---|
| Foundation Damage | Water pooling around your house | Fractures, shifting, and instability |
| Roof Damage | Backed-up water affecting the roof | Leaks, mold, and structural concerns |
| Landscaping Erosion | Water removing soil | Damage to plants and gardens |
| Pest Infestation | Stagnant water bring in insects | Increased risk of illness |
Kinds Of Guttering Systems
Guttering systems been available in various products, each offering special benefits and drawbacks. Below are the most typical types of gutters utilized in homes:
Table 2: Types of Guttering Materials
| Material |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|
| Aluminum | Lightweight, corrosion-resistant | Can flex under heavy weight |
| Vinyl | Affordable, easy to install | Less durable in extreme climates |
| Steel | Very strong and long lasting | Prone to rust if not correctly covered |
| Copper | Visual appeal, lasting | Expensive and requires professional installation |
| Zinc | Extremely durable and corrosion-resistant | Can be quite costly |

Guttering Installation Process
When setting up a gutter system, homeowners should understand the basic process included:
- Assessment: Evaluate the roof and determine the best type of gutter system.
- Measurements: Take accurate measurements of the perimeter of the roof to compute the quantity of products needed.
- Product Selection: Choose the gutter material that best matches the home and local conditions.
- Installation: Properly set up the guttering system, ensuring it is pitched to direct water towards downspouts.
- Sealing and Testing: Seal joints and evaluate the system to make sure there are no leakages.

Maintenance Tips for Guttering
To keep gutter systems operating optimally, routine maintenance is vital. Here are some maintenance tips:
- Regular Cleaning: Remove leaves, twigs, and debris a minimum of two times a year.
- Inspect for Damage: Check for rust, cracks, and other signs of damage.
- Ensure Proper Pitch: Make sure gutters are properly pitched to enable water to flow towards downspouts.
- Flush Downspouts: Ensure downspouts are clear by flushing them with water.
- Install Gutter Guards: Consider including gutter guards to lower debris build-up.
